VFX Toolbox v1.0.1 (Build 6) is now available on the Mac App Store & TestFlight! 🥳

This update contains the following improvements:

  • Improves timeline marker accuracy and fixes several issues affecting VFX Delivery exports.
  • Correct marker placement for clips with multiple markers.
  • More accurate VFX Delivery timecodes and frame-aligned clip trimming.
  • Improved handling of nested and sync clip marker extraction.
  • Resolved duplicate marker placement when compound clips share source footage.
  • Additional stability and workflow improvements.

Jumper v2026.03.30 has now been released for macOS (Apple silicon + Intel) and Windows.

For macOS: preferred way to update is to use the "auto-check for updates"-function in the Jumper launcher app.

For Windows: download and run installer from the Jumper website.

🥳 New Features:

  • Folder hierarchy in the media panel: browse your media organized by folder structure, Final Cut Pro Libraries & Events, and bins across all NLE platforms.
  • Export and import Watch Folder configurations as JSON files: easily back up or transfer your watch folder setups.
  • Analysis folder repair tool: fixes a bug where using multiple different analysis folders could cause data to "bleed" between them, with the option to remove analysis data for deleted source media.
  • Final Cut Pro Creator Studio v12 (subscription) is now supported.

🔨 Improvements:

  • You can now paste file paths directly into the Watch Folders dialog.
  • Keyboard navigation for folder selection in the media panel.
  • Script Inspector now shows selected item counts in button labels.
  • Refreshed splash screen with new visual effects and branding.
  • Improved contrast for selected segments in Script Inspector (light mode).
  • Watch Folders processing is now faster with larger batch sizes and reduced wait times.

🐞 Bug Fixes:

  • Fixed a bug where silence segments could show negative durations in Script Inspector.
  • Fixed incorrect cropping of BRAW and R3D files during visual analysis.
  • Fixed transcription and people analysis data not being cleared when switching analysis folders.
  • Fixed an issue where multiple analysis jobs could run concurrently.
  • Fixed misaligned folder icon in Shared Scan MXF Metadata section.
  • Fixed a brief flash of the onboarding overlay on app startup.

Mat X writes on the FCP Cafe Discord:

Hi. I wanted to share my FCP Backup Manager app with everyone.

It's free. And it watches your Final Cut Pro backups in ~/Movies and ZIP's up the .fcpbundles to any locations you want.

I use it to backup all my clients' Final Cut Pro project backups on their workstations to shared storage where my Archiware P5 backups run.

But you can use it to move to any NAS, SSD or whatever you prefer.

Those Final Cut Pro project backups can be a real life saver. Also has MDM and JSON easy config options when you're managing more than your own workstation.

Marker Data v2.0.0 by Vigneswaran Rajkumar is out now.

Marker Data now only supports macOS Sequoia v15.7 or later, starting with version v2.0.0.

🔨 Improvements:

  • Overhaul Marker Data's GUI to Liquid Glass
  • Updated Marker Data's application icon for macOS Tahoe
  • Verified to run under macOS Tahoe and Final Cut Pro 12
  • Excel export profile now has the ability to automatically embed images
  • Improved compatibility of CSV export profile and TSV export profile when data contains special characters
  • Added support and compatibility for FCPXML v1.14 (Final Cut Pro 12)
  • Added support for Final Cut Pro Creator Studio (Subscription Version)
  • Dock Icon's Progress now uses Squircle Style
  • Updated Airtable Module Airlift to version 1.3.3
  • Updated Notion Module CSV2Notion Neo to version 2.1.0
  • Updated Pagemaker Module to version 1.1.1
  • Marker Data's Uninstaller has been rewritten in Swift
  • Updated core dependencies
  • Codebase updates for Xcode 26.4

🐞 Bug Fix:

  • Removed unintended exposure of the XML Path column in Notion Database Profile
  • Fixed an issue that prevented macOS notifications for Marker Data
  • Fixed an issue that caused Dropbox setup to fail on macOS Tahoe due to Apple restrictions
  • Fixed an issue where the Dock Icon progress toggle was not working
  • Fixed an issue where the Queue table sort was not working
  • Embedding extracted images with Swatch Palette is not supported for Excel Profile
